    C1 engine bracket bolts

    What are the correct bolt markings for the metal spark plug shields and ignition shield brackets for a 61? I can't find them in the Paragon or Corvette Central catalogues, and their tech support doesn't know since they tell me they aren't reproduced.

    Ron -

    The spark plug HEAT shields are attached with 1/4"-20 x 1/2" hex bolts; don't know what the headmark is supposed to be, but Paragon has 4 or 5 varieties of this size bolt. The ignition shield brackets (that accept the shield wing-bolts) are attached under the head of the exhaust manifold bolts.

        I went nutz with bolt questions...

        ...Last year. Basically, Paragon etc. will supply excellent hardware, but GM bought ordinary hardware from numerous supplers, usually several at the same time, to avoid running short. The sway bar bracket bolts on my car are untouched originals, yet 3 are plain unmarked, one is "WB 1C". Of course, new supplies were tossed into the bin on top of the old, regardless of supplier. This would mean that car #501 might have different bolt heads than car #500. The best you can do is talk to judges and find out what the possibilities are, or check original fasteners on cars of similar VIN. Just about nobody is going to go out on a limb and say "you need bolt head X", and if they do, they might disagree and still be right. BTW, I couldn't find some of the markings I wanted from Corvette suppliers, but 55-57 Chevy suppliers were able to help.

          Ron--
          I've found "E", "TR", and "RBW" bolts in those locations. Those are also the primary suppliers for oil pan 1/4 x 20 bolts in that era. They are dished-head bolts. Hope that helps.
